bar work pay

Can anyone tell me how much I could earn working in a bar.I have experience,and also what does a chef earn? Please help as we are moving over in August.

bar work average 6.50€ hr,chef about the same.thats if you can find work at all its nearly impossible!

Very true Trev. The rates of pay can be higher or lower than this but it does depend on the town (different pay in different resorts!), what the job is and your own experience.

The important point to make is that getting work in the middle of the high season is very hard in the best years and with the island like the rest of the world suffering from the recession it would be important to make considerations before you come and commit to a move that you may go several months (or longer) without finding work. We suggest that you consider coming on a finding trip before to see if you are able to line up a job beforehand rather than making the move, burning through money and then having to go home. Don't get me wrong I'm not predicting doom and gloom I just like people to be realistic that the competition for bar work out here is very high!

Well it is definitely better to come out here before the season starts as bar owners generally know how many staff they may require and so plan accordingly. It is always tough to find work and certainly not possible without walking a good few kms ... good walking shoes ... photo & CV ... smile ... usually enough to get you started here. But don't bank on finding work especially not straight away and keep enough money to see you through a while whilst you are looking ... remember those that have lived here a while have seen people come and go!
